/ Dictionary / Index H hypobaropathy: Meaning and Definition of Find definitions for: hy•po•ba•rop•a•thy Pronunciation: (hī"pō-bu-rop'u-thē), [key] — n. Pathol. a condition produced in high altitudes, caused by diminished air pressure and reduced oxygen intake; mountain sickness.
